In 1999, Kerryne Krause, “decided to embark on the arduous and complex
journey of developing an eye care product that really works and really
delivers sustainable results, but had no idea back then that it would take
almost 10 years to develop and perfect my product.”
I-Slices® Technology – a first in the world – is a unique Cryogel dermal
delivery system with its applications in the cosmetics, veterinary &
medical industries.
Manufactured in SA (in a globally unique facility) and exported to various
countries since 2007,eyeSlices® (the first of a range of innovations) is a
proudly South African story that spans more than 10 years of Research &
Development and boasts a manufacturing process for the technology that
is globally unique.
It is a story of perseverance, resourcefulness and overcoming a multitude

100 most influential poeple south africa


of obstacles in the advanced manufacturing & life sciences technology
space.

Kate and Carol may have been the daughters of the man who introduced rural Nkomazi small-scale farmers to cane AWAY WITHOUT A WILL?
growing in the 1990s, but neither thought they would ever work full-time in the cane industry. Both studied commerce
degrees and, with few employment opportunities in the region, both moved to Johannesburg where Kate became an IT
programmer and Carol worked in the financial services industry. Yet they both desired to ultimately return home and ‘give
back’ to their community in some way.
At the end of 2007, a friend sent them a tender advertisement for the supply of cane-cutting services to one of the commu- WE CAN HELP YOU DRAW UP A
nity-based joint ventures that RCL FOODS had recently entered with land claimant communities in the Nkomazi area. As LAST WILL & TESTAMENT TO
land claim beneficiaries themselves, Kate and Carol were eligible to apply – and despite their lack of sugar cane farming PROTECT YOUR CHILDREN AND
experience, the sisters seized the opportunity to create their own enterprise.
THEIR INHERITANCE
They presented their business plan for Kaylorac cane cutting services to the tender adjudicators with impressive profes-
sionalism and were awarded the contract in early 2008.
Starting the business wasn’t easy as the owners had no funding other than their pensions and some credit assistance
through their family. Nevertheless they made a go of it, and augmented their knowledge with studies along the way.
Today, Kaylorac employs nearly 300 people and provides cane cutting and other farming support services to their
community’s joint venture cane company (Libuyile Farming Services) and other sugarcane growers in the Nkomazi area.
Together they also run a thriving events company and venue, Shonga Events.

Mpho Mookapele
CEO
Energy and Water SETA

Her career spans more than 15 years in the finance and


regulatory environment in both the private and public
sectors.
Her career highlight was being promoted to senior manag-
er at Ernst & Young where she led strategic planning and
reporting solutions in the public sector. Mookapele has been
CEO at the energy and water Seta for over two years after
being hired as CFO in 2016.
As CFO, she encountered many opportunities to enrich
herselfat the cost of her moral standards and at the cost of
the future of young South Africans, but always chose to do

100 most influential poeple south africa


the right thing.
As CEO since the age of 35, her executive leadership and
accountability to the board has highlighted the importance
of strategic leadership governed by ethics
In 2019, SAICA awarded Mpho the 2019 overall winner of
government

the SAICA Top-35-under-35 CA (SA) Competition

Boitumelo Phakathi
Specialist Surgeon and Consultant

science &technology
As a younger surgeon, with only a few fe-
male surgeons at the time and overcom-
ing the challenges of being a woman in a
male-dominated field led Phakathi to real-
ise the responsibility she had to ensure that
female surgeons after her are supported
and mentored to fast-track their success.
She then decided to start the Boitumelo
Phakathi Foundation, which focuses on
career advancement and career develop-
ment for youth in rural areas.
Born and raised in the North West village
of Taung, Phakathi describes herself as
a “humble, smart and ambitious young
woman who has a steadfast faith in God of
impossibilities”.
The 33-year-old is in the process of com-
pleting her PhD in the molecular biology
of breast cancer and HIV. She says breast
cancer and HIV are both burning issues in
women’s health in our time but not a lot
is understood and known about these two
diseases — especially when they co-exist.
Beyond her PhD, Phakathi is working to-
wards her professorship by improving her
teaching profile, research and polishing
up her leadership skills to prepare her for
her ultimate goal of being a vice chancel-
lor someday. She currently lectures, pub-
lishes and supervises master’s students at
Wits University.
She also runs her own foundation, the Boi-
tumelo Phakathi Education Foundation. It
focuses on personal development and ca-
reer advancement of youths in rural areas.

Newcastle born author and Faith Sithole is passionate when it comes to address-
ing the unfavourable issues women endure and the toxic relationships potentially
destroying their lives.
Faith wrote a book titled, Healing a Bruised Heart of a Broken Woman. Discussing
her book, Faith explains, her journey began due to adverse experiences encoun-
tered in past relationships. she admits to trying to take her own life on countless
occasions. However, for some reason, her attempts were never successful. She
said “The common thing that most women find themselves in, is when they over-
stay a relationship that they were supposed to have left a long time ago.”
Today, through her writing and speaking, she is bringing healing to many women,
and help with the numerous challenges the female population still endures. One of
these hurdles is that women still do not have a voice in modern society.

Hilton Petersen
Founder
Jesus Collective
Hilton Petersen is the President of Collective Records, a record label, and the
founder of The Jesus Collective, a music ministry that consists of a collective
of well-known and upcoming musicians and singers who have a passion for
spreading the gospel throughout Africa and the world.
Hilton grew up in the small town of Ashton, situated in the Western Cape
Winelands of South Africa on the longest wine route called Robertson. Raised
by Sandra, a God fearing, prayer warrior mother who was the sole breadwinner
for the family, she remained faithful and strong in prayer despite their years in
poverty, where they spent 18 years living in a tin shack.
Hilton’s heart is to see people come to experience the love of Jesus through
worship, and with The Jesus Collective events, this ministry reaches all
demographics of people from the richest to the poorest.
He holds events in poor towns that may never have the opportunity to
experience famous artists perform in their lifetimes.

Charmaine Smith co-founded Infundo Consulting in 2007. After
working as a key associate since 2008 to co-develop and integrate
systems work into Infundo Consulting. Infundo Consulting is a
social enterprise focused on performance across all industries;
based on working with and shifting Human Behaviour.
Infundo has focused predominantly on the development space:
education; community development; District and social impact
across geographical areas as well as into corporate spaces which
include a focus and understanding of development as a platform
for transformation. This reflects our ongoing passion for impact
across South Africa and the African continent.

100 most influential poeple south africa


Working predominantly in education; but also more broadly in
communities Infundo designs sustainable solutions. Our associ-
ates and partners are all committed to our country’s future; for
sustainable improvement in our societies and communities. They
are all truly African; sharing a common heart for Nation Building.
